Output 16e5380f719f20a25bf00abd7e2acd2138de9777b09fce5afe23cc22c65aef00:0

value
536414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b75cf4352aac93c5aff26c662431de49830372 OP_EQUAL
address
3KiShdG3VGFJTdX4k2qhvA6QsMCVAMkPG8
transaction
16e5380f719f20a25bf00abd7e2acd2138de9777b09fce5afe23cc22c65aef00
confirmations
316560
spent
true